The colitis model chicks were used in this study. The modern molecular biology techniques combined with traditional pathology testing methods were used for discovering the changes of the number of white blood cells in blood and dendritic cells in cecal tonsil, the expression of TNF-α、 TLR-4、IL-10mRNA in colon, the clinical signs and pathological changes. The study aimed at artificially copying the colitis with2,4,6-trinitrobenzene sulfonic acid solution mixed with50%ethanol (TNBS ethanol mixture) and showing the inhibition of inflammation and influence of innate immunity in colitis chicks after the application of probiotics. The results showed that:1. TNBS ethanol mixture can be given through the gut of chicks successfully replicated in animal models of ulcerative colitis.2. It is3to8days after chicks was given TNBS ethanol mixture through the gut of them. The number of leukocytes, eosinophils and basophils in their peripheral blood is different degrees higher than the control chicks (P<0.05or P<0.01), but it is significantly or very significantly (P <0.05or P<0.01) higher than the control chicks at the4day.3. It is3to8days after chicks was given TNBS ethanol mixture through the gut of them. The expression levels of TNF-α, TLR-4, IL-10mRNA in their colon tissue are various degrees higher than the control chicks (P<0.05or P<0.01). Those results indicated that TNBS ethanol mixture could significantly promote the differentiation and maturation of chicks’ white blood cells in their peripheral blood and it also could synthetic and release a large number of pro-inflammatory cytokines. So it could expansion the role of inflammation in the damage to the body.4. It is3to8days after chicks was given TNBS ethanol mixture through the gut of them. The number of leukocytes, eosinophils and basophils in their peripheral blood is significantly or very significantly (P<0.05or P<0.01) higher than the ulcerative colitis chicks intervened by the application of probiotics, but it is significantly or very significantly (P<0.05or P<0.01) lower than them at the4day.5. It is3to8days after chicks was given TNBS ethanol mixture through the gut of them. The expression levels of TNF-α and TLR-4mRNA in their colon tissue are significantly or very significantly (P<0.05or P<0.01) higher than the ulcerative colitis chicks intervened by the application of probiotics, but IL-10mRNA expression level is significantly or very significantly (P<0,05or P<0.01) lower than the ulcerative colitis chicks intervened by the application of probiotics. Those results indicated that probiotics not only could upregulate the expression of anti-inflammatory cytokines gene, but also downregulate the expression of pro-inflammatory cytokines gene. So it can suppress the occurrence and development of inflammation to achieve remission of inflammation symptoms and reduce inflammation the damage to the body.6. It is3to14days after chicks was given TNBS ethanol mixture through the gut of them. The number of dendritic cells in their cecal tonsil were significantly or very significantly (P<0.05or P<0.01) lower than ulcerative colitis chicks intervened by the application of probiotics and control chicks.7. It is3to14days after chicks was given TNBS ethanol mixture through the gut of them. Their body weight were different levels lower than the control chicks and the ulcerative colitis chicks intervened by the application of probiotics (P<0.05or P<0.01).
